Found out not all 73-87 side windows interchange

Actually, the glass appears to be the same but if the track is different the window will not roll up completely.

I discovered this yesterday while I was trying to replace the driverside window in my '86 GMC 1500 because Wednesday I was mowing the lawn next to my gravel driveway and when I got done you can imagine what I found. So, after retrieving a window from the local junk yard I got the thing installed yesterday morning.

I'd noticed that the track looked different on the window they gave me. It was more like the track in a 67-72 window but figured it wouldn't matter. Well it would only roll up about 3/4 of the way and after spending the rest of the morning taking it out, getting another window with a track that matched the original, I finally got it right.

Re: Found out not all 73-87 side windows interchange

Well they do interchange but if you use the older window in a newer truck or vise versa you also need to change the vent window assembly to match the same year glass. If you do this it all works/fits fine.

In my 86 somone had broken the vent window out to try and steal what they thought was a CD player sitting on the dash. When they found out it was an ancient radar detector they left it. We used one of the spare vent windows from the 76 and one of the spare windows from it as a replacement. Works fine!

Re: Found out not all 73-87 side windows interchange

Quote:
Originally Posted by Old Yeller 1970
Did you have to change regulators or are they all the same?

The 86 regulator stayed. The only difference between the different year regulators is the crank peice the handel attaches to, it's 1/2" or so longer to accomodate the different (larger) style door panel.

I have already been where the company that makes the kit for Brothers is. It would have cost me $350 for a set of JUST the glass and they wouldn't touch it unless I could purchase a MINIMUM of 10 sets at one hit, AND if my mold was off, I had to EAT the other 10 sets and Do it all over again 10 set at a time.... Which is why you don't see mine availible yet...

This doesn't include all the new hardware, and weatherstripping. Trust me, $775 is a reasonable price for markup on this item. If I got mine put together, I wouldn't dare sell it for less than $600... at a minimum.
